Andreas Geist is a scholar working on Inorganic Chemistry, Materials Chemistry and Industrial and Manufacturing Engineering. According to data from OpenAlex, Andreas Geist has authored 153 papers receiving a total of 5.6k indexed citations (citations by other indexed papers that have themselves been cited), including 139 papers in Inorganic Chemistry, 100 papers in Materials Chemistry and 62 papers in Industrial and Manufacturing Engineering. Recurrent topics in Andreas Geist's work include Radioactive element chemistry and processing (138 papers), Chemical Synthesis and Characterization (62 papers) and Lanthanide and Transition Metal Complexes (55 papers). Andreas Geist is often cited by papers focused on Radioactive element chemistry and processing (138 papers), Chemical Synthesis and Characterization (62 papers) and Lanthanide and Transition Metal Complexes (55 papers). Andreas Geist collaborates with scholars based in Germany, United Kingdom and France. Andreas Geist's co-authors include Petra J. Panak, Giuseppe Modolo, Andreas Wilden, Udo Müllich, Michael Weigl, Daniel Magnusson, Michael J. Hudson, Rikard Malmbeck, Κ. Gompper and Robin J. Taylor and has published in prestigious journals such as Chemical Reviews, SHILAP Revista de lepidopterología and Chemical Communications.
